A man returning from Angola was confirmed Vietnam’s latest Covid-19 case Wednesday, taking the national tally to 1,173.

"Patient 1173" is a 43-year old man from Ha Tinh Province who landed October 20 at the Van Don International Airport in the northern province of Quang Ninh on Vietnam Airlines flight VN8.

He is the 14th person on this flight to test positive for the novel coronavirus. Quarantined upon arrival in the northern province of Bac Ninh, he is being treated at the provincial general hospital.

Of Vietnam’s 1,173 Covid-19 patients, 1,062 have recovered and 35 have died.

The active patients are all in stable condition, with 16 having tested negative for the virus at least once.

Vietnam has gone 55 days without a community transmission.

Nearly 15,000 people are quarantined – 13,000 in quarantine facilities, 170 in hospitals and the rest at home or other designated accommodations.

The Covid-19 pandemic has claimed over 1.1 million lives globally.
